Its intentional ambiguity sparks existential questions about instinctual and imposed attachment, affection, and alienation that, for many, have risen to the forefront of our awareness during a year of quarantine.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e'To me, parenting is a very interesting source for material because of its messiness. It’s complex and ambivalent and unstable. There is tenderness but there is also anger. There is attraction but there is also repulsion. And if you pull on these strings, everything comes together: sexuality, love, death, and much more.' - Camille Henrot\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eABOUT MOCA\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eFounded in 1979, MOCA is the defining museum of contemporary art. This particular image belongs to a series I have been working on for several years titled \u003cem\u003eFlorilegio (An Anthology)\u003c\/em\u003e, a selection of flower images taken with a broken camera. There's no other kind of manipulation except for the one produced by the technical imperfections of the machine. These conceptual explorations look far more like watercolors or pastel paintings than a photograph. This complex relationship among mediums remains constant in my work.\"\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The distorted flower photographs of \u003cem\u003eFlorilegio\u003c\/em\u003e, taken in Iraola's garden in Miami with a defective Canon digital camera, have a unique pictorial quality formed by layers of vibrant colors, deformed shapes, and lush textures that are beautiful and unexpected.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Artspace","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":47192152244324,"sku":"5056880805476","price":500.0,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0711\/5292\/6820\/files\/jose_iraola_888_ORIG_f19835ce-bafa-44bb-b01c-983148fb0ba2.jpg?v=1764694689"},{"product_id":"michael-bauer-baba-creme-5056880805599","title":"Baba Creme","description":"\u003cp\u003eThe imagery for this edition is derived in part from what Michael Bauer calls his “telephone drawings” - quick, loose sketches made while talking on the phone or otherwise distracted. Bauer saves these doodles, no matter how rough or silly, and uses them as raw materials to be copied, scanned, altered, and combined. \u003c\/p\u003e \u003cp\u003eBauer often works in series, making groups of paintings that metaphorically “talk back” to one another while simultaneously standing on their own as individual works. As he says, “Every painting that I do relies on the last twenty I did.” In a neat literalization of his process, this print includes the words “baba” and “creme,” recurring terms Bauer uses as verbal readymades for their phonetic qualities and mutable meanings.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Artspace","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":47192177672292,"sku":"5056880805599","price":700.0,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0711\/5292\/6820\/files\/michael-bauer-baba-creme-ORIG.jpg?v=1770047656"},{"product_id":"tara-walters-the-cathedrals-of-central-park-dog-on-leash-5056880811453","title":"The Cathedrals of Central Park: Dog on Leash","description":"\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eArtspace is pleased to present \u003cem\u003eThe Cathedrals of Central Park\u003c\/em\u003e, 2025, a striking new edition of 40 unique hand-painted prints by Tara Walters.\u003c\/b\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eWorking across drawing, painting, and mixed media, Walters constructs dreamlike settings that feel both familiar and enchanted.
